Murano glass chandelier by Gino Poli Sotis, Italy, 1970s

This fascinating pendant lamp from the 70s, designed by Ettore Fantasia and Gino Poli for Sotis Murano, best expresses the material experimentation and refinement of Venetian artistic glass.

The large diffuser is entirely handcrafted in transparent glass using the “pulegoso” technique, which involves the deliberate inclusion of small air bubbles within the glass mass, creating a soft, luminous texture that diffuses light with a velvety effect.

To interrupt and enhance the transparent surface, a horizontal band of “lattimo” glass — opaque white glass rich in microcrystals — elegantly crosses the dome, adding a distinctive and sophisticated graphic detail.

A rare and spectacular piece, perfect for enhancing modern, eclectic or vintage environments with a light point rich in personality and history.
